Template:Magazine Beep! MegaDrive (ビープ!メガドライブ) was a monthly magazine sold within Japan that focused on the Sega Mega Drive. It was the successor to Beep!, a multi-format magazine which had given significant coverage to the Sega Master System at a time when most other Japanese publications focused almost solely on the Famicom.
The magazine continued until 1995 when it was rebranded Sega Saturn Magazine and focused on the Sega Saturn.

Serialization
- Dokusya Race: Reader's rating
- Urawaza League: Tips and Tricks
- Mega-Dra Tatsujin Kouza: Game walkthrough
- Thunderbirds are go go!: Game walkthrough
- Genesis Jouhoukyoku: Oversea information and games review. Renamed BeMega Genesis Information later.
- Laser Active Library: Laser Active games review. Renamed Mega LD Library later.
- Sega Game Toshokan book review: Sega Game Toshokan games review.
- Tera communication: Teradrive and Sega Game Toshokan games review. Later renamed Teradrive PC collection.
- Horai gakuen nyuugaku annai: About Horai gakuen.
